I have amahi installed and working fine. As I was moving my files from my pc to the server I kept getting hd full, which was a small landing zone. All of my PCs could see all of the share except my main computer I work on could get in to and look at what was inside and everything else could not get past the folder name. Well I moved the LZ to a larger drive in the pool per the wiki page. After doing that everything worked fine except all my PCs can not get to the shares except the one I'm transferring my files from. I have checked the shares and it is set to everyone on all the shared folders. I also have another login on the server jim and chris. On my pc I see all folders and the jokjr folder I created under my name but not crood for the other log in. On the Laptop when chris goes to the \\hda under network he sees only crood folder that was created and not anything else. Headed to see if I can find anything else out. So if anyone can help thanks.

Check the permissions of /var/hda/files. The folders should be owned by your first admin user:users.

Recommend you check out the shares troubleshooter in the wiki.
